Titan Ultra posts first win by claiming San Miguel scalp

Giant Risers spoil Beermen's conference debut

ANTIPOLO - Titan Ultra shocked San Miguel, 119-112, on Saturday for its first win in the PBA 50th Season Commissioner's Cup at the Ynares Center.

The Giant Risers scored 41 points in the third to lead by as many as 21 points, spoiling the Beermen's return to action since capturing the Philippine Cup title last February.

Titan Ultra also weathered a Beermen comeback powered by an all-Filipino line-up that saw them come within four points while import Marcus Lee watched from the bench.

It was a huge victory for Titan Ultra, which lost by 41 points, 158-117, in their November 12 showdown to San Miguel and lost its first two games of the midseason conference by an average of 31.5 points.

Joshua Munzon had 29 points, and Michael Gilmore finished with 28 points and 13 rebounds while playing with five fouls in the final stretch.

    Rensy Bajar picked up his first win as PBA head coach.

    “‘Yung motivation lang namin this game is we were outplayed for the last two games, blowout losses against Terrafirma and Phoenix. Ang challenge lang namin is have some pride on their jobs and in this team because this Titan team can beat anybody,” said Bajar.

    Gilmore knocked down a three with 3:20 left in the third quarter for an 83-62 lead, the biggest of the game, but a fiery run enabled San Miguel to come to within four points, 112-108.

    Titan Ultra responded with Cade Flores burying a putback and Munzon scoring a lay-up to put the situation back under control.

    Marcus Lee scored four points before being benched in the final quarter.

    Cjay Perez had 27 points, and Don Trollano added 21 points, but Lee had four points, five rebounds, three assists, and three steals in 24 minutes of action before being benched the entire fourth period.

    The scores:

    Titan Ultra 119 – Munzon 29, Gilmore 28, Flores 13, Yu 9, Javillonar 8, Ular 6, Sajonia 5, Balanza 4, Omega 4, Cuntapay 4, Pessumal 4, Melecio 3, Dionisio 2, Sangco 0.

    San Miguel 112 – Perez 27, Trollano 21, Tautuaa 18, Fajardo 15, Teng 9, Rosales 7, Lassiter 6, Lee 4, Tiongson 3, Brondial 2, Cahilig 0, Miller 0.

    Quarters: 28-18; 52-49; 93-75; 119-112.
